Output dd5ba7dfdcd5006fd1d91fb4fa5dc864d8cfb0aa75b860cdf82ef8023f12bea5:1

value
7726014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a4518afb00c6be7e04152be46ae3c0451c8c33 OP_EQUAL
address
398hW8h63xB3jdrhNK3X7jBCu4bKz4Myoa
transaction
dd5ba7dfdcd5006fd1d91fb4fa5dc864d8cfb0aa75b860cdf82ef8023f12bea5
confirmations
357521
spent
true